The square of 9 less than a number is 3 less than the number. What is the number?

Answer:

The number is 12 or 7.

Step-by-step explanation:

According to question,

The square of 9 less than a number is 3 less than the number.

i.e. [tex](x - 9)^2 = x - 3[/tex]

Solving the equation,

[tex]x^2 - 18x + 81= x - 3[/tex]

[tex]x^2 - 19x + 84 = 0 [/tex]

[tex](x - 12)(x - 7) = 0 [/tex]

[tex](x - 12)=0,(x - 7) = 0 [/tex]

[tex]x=12,7 [/tex]

Therefore, The number is 12 or 7.
